タグ

関連タグで絞り込む (185)

タグの絞り込みを解除

APIに関するbasiのブックマーク (146)

  • Yahoo!みんなの検定の受験機能APIの紹介

    ヤフー株式会社は、2023年10月1日にLINEヤフー株式会社になりました。LINEヤフー株式会社の新しいブログはこちらです。LINEヤフー Tech Blog Yahoo!みんなの検定ProjectのK.K.です。 3か月以上の間が空いてしまいましたが、みんなの検定のAPIで【「三国志」に関する検定を表示し、受験する】機能の最後の仕上げを紹介します。 前々回で検定リストAPI、前回で検定詳細APIを使いました。 今回は「検定受験API」を使ってみましょう。 この検定受験APIでは、以下の3種のパラメータが必要です。 cert_id(検定ID) qid(各問題IDをコンマ区切りでつなげたもの) answer(選んだ選択肢の番号をコンマ区切りでつなげたもの) これらを送信することで合否の判定や評価メッセージを返すことが出来ます。 では最初に、問題IDとユーザーの解答を送信するための受験フォー

    Yahoo!みんなの検定の受験機能APIの紹介
    basi
    basi 2009/04/28
  • GT Nitro: カーレーシング・ドラッグレーシングゲーム - Google Play のアプリ

    GT Nitro: Car Game Drag Raceは、典型的なカーゲームではありません。これはスピード、パワー、スキル全開のカーレースゲームです。ブレーキは忘れて、これはドラッグレース、ベイビー!古典的なクラシックから未来的なビーストまで、最もクールで速い車とカーレースできます。スティックシフトをマスターし、ニトロを賢く使って競争を打ち破る必要があります。このカーレースゲームはそのリアルな物理学と素晴らしいグラフィックスであなたの心を爆発させます。これまでプレイしたことのないようなものです。 GT Nitroは、リフレックスとタイミングを試すカーレースゲームです。正しい瞬間にギアをシフトし、ガスを思い切り踏む必要があります。また、大物たちと競いつつ、車のチューニングとアップグレードも行わなければなりません。世界中で最高のドライバーと車とカーレースに挑むことになり、ドラッグレースの王冠

    GT Nitro: カーレーシング・ドラッグレーシングゲーム - Google Play のアプリ
  • 「mixiアプリ」を8月に正式公開、開発者への報酬も公表

    Windows SQL Server 2005サポート終了の4月12日が迫る、報告済み脆弱性の深刻度も高く、早急な移行を

  • livedoor

    1新型コロナ接触確認アプリ『COCOA』、不具合を見つけるための...オレ的ゲーム速報@... 2教室で授業中に缶酎ハイ、小学校教諭を減給3か月「衝動的に飲...痛いニュース(ノ∀`... 3【文春砲】フジテレビの女子アナさん、完全にアウト!!!.......NEWSまとめもりー|... 4【謎】スズメの死骸をほとんど見かけない理由不思議.net 5の心霊体験あるある「ビニール袋の背後霊」まめきちまめこニー... 6新型コロナ接触アプリ『COCOA』不具合を厚労省が調査・報告 →...はちま起稿 7【社民党常任幹事】伊是名夏子さんから差別する日社会へのあ...ハムスター速報 8中日ドラゴンズさん、ここ10試合平均1.6点なんじぇいスタジア... 9旭川の14歳女子中学生いじめ凍死事件って哲学ニュースnwk 10【呆然】郵便受けに「息子さんはまだ無職ですか」「息子さんは...稲速報 1

    livedoor
  • 「mixi始まって以来、最大の変化」――笠原社長に聞く「mixiアプリ」

    「mixi始まって以来、一番大きな変化だ」――ミクシィの笠原健治社長は、「mixiアプリ」に大きな期待を寄せている。 mixiアプリは、外部開発者がmixi向けアプリケーションを開発できるプラットフォームで、4月8日にオープンβ版をスタートした。8月に正式公開し、mixiユーザー全体に公開する予定だ(「mixiアプリ」8月に正式公開 販売収入8割を開発者に 広告収入も)。 笠原社長が期待するのは、mixi日記に並ぶような、強力なコミュニケーションアプリの登場だ。日記はmixiで最も使われている機能で、ユーザーがmixiにアクセスする最大の理由になっているが、日記が嫌いでmixiは使わない、という人もいる。 「日記は、20代女性には使いやすいかもしれないが、30代後半の男性や、家族同士、上司や部下などのコミュニケーション方法としてはベストではないかもしれない」――外部開発者の力を借り、それぞ

    「mixi始まって以来、最大の変化」――笠原社長に聞く「mixiアプリ」
  • APIとの通信効率をよくする実装例(2) 簡易キャッシュ

    こうして見ると、仮に5分程度ライムラグがあってもさほど影響が無いものが多い、つまり毎度APIに問い合わせるのが無駄とも言えないでしょうか。(毎度通信すべきはなのは、上の表では「高」の部分のみ)。 そこで、APIから取ってきたデータ(XML)を少しの時間だけとっておくのはどうでしょう?(リアルタイム性が高いものや検索結果については毎度通信し、それ以外のものはキープしておき再利用)アクセスしてきたAさん、Bさん、Cさん・・・誰が見ても同じ内容ならなおさらみんなでシェアできれば、通信の数もそれにかかる時間も減るはずです。 このように一定時間データを溜めて再利用するシステムや行為を、キャッシュ(cache ※1)といいます。 どんな言語でも、こんな流れのロジックが書ければ実現できるでしょう。 if ( とっておいたXMLが賞味期限切れ ) { 捨てる; } if ( とっておいたXMLがある )

    APIとの通信効率をよくする実装例(2) 簡易キャッシュ
  • はじめての mixi アプリ - IT戦記

    IE ではたぶん動きません。 友達一覧取得 <?xml version="1.0" encoding="UTF-8" ?> <Module> <ModulePrefs title="simple mixi Appli"> <Require feature="opensocial-0.8"/> </ModulePrefs> <Content type="html"> <![CDATA[ <script type="text/javacript"> var req = opensocial.newDataRequest(); req.add(req.newFetchPeopleRequest(opensocial.newIdSpec({ userId: 'OWNER', groupId: 'FRIENDS' }), { max: 1000 }), 'friends'); req.send(fu

    はじめての mixi アプリ - IT戦記
  • 駅データ 無料ダウンロード 『駅データ.jp』

    2019.04.05 三陸鉄道リアス線移管対応/石勝線 夕張支線各駅廃止/Jヴィレッジ駅追加/初台・幡ヶ谷 を京王線から削除 2019.03.17 昨日更新の「浜町アーケード駅」の登録に誤りがありましたので訂正しました 2019.03.16 おおさか東線/ゆりかもめ/長崎電気軌道ほか50件程度更新 2018.04.24 Osaka Metro(4/1)追加/大阪市交通局は民営化に伴う名称・事業所変更 北陸新幹線の事業者コードについて 駅データ.jpの仕様上、1路線には1事業者コードしか登録できません。 北陸新幹線はJR東日JR西日が運営していますが、駅データ.jpではJR東日の事業者コードのみ登録していますのでご注意ください。 【有料会員登録のお振り込みをされた方へ】 有料会員としてお振り込みをしたら、必ず「ダウンロード」の「有料会員登録」から「お振り込みの報告」をしてください。

  • Google App Engine for Javaを使ってみよう! (1)Google Plugin for Eclipse

    2008年4月7日に発表されたGoogle App Engineが、ちょうど1年後の2009年4月7日にJavaに対応したことが発表されました。さらに、Java開発には必須のEclipse用のプラグイン「Google Plugin for Eclipse」が同時に発表され、Java利用者は簡単にGoogle App Engine用のプログラム開発とEclipse上からのデプロイができるようになっています。今回はそんな便利な「Google Plugin for Eclipse」の使い方を説明します。 はじめに 2008年4月7日、Googleのインフラでウェブサービスを展開できるという「Google App Engine」が発表され世界中が驚かされました。この時点では利用できる言語としてPythonのみがサポートされており、Pythonの開発者がGoogleの社員であることを考えると当然なの

    Google App Engine for Javaを使ってみよう! (1)Google Plugin for Eclipse
  • Memorium: 眺めるインタフェースの提案とその試作|persistent.org

    すきま時間を利用して「偶然」を積極的に利用 生活に常駐する環境型アプリケーション 概要 近年,Web 上の情報が爆発的に増大したことやストレージ量の増大などで,個人が多量の情報を利用する機会が増えている.またユビキタス社会に向けた取り組みの研究も盛んである.今後,ますます多くの情報がより多様な情報機器で利用されるであろうが,それに伴いユーザの情報機器に対する操作の複雑化が懸念される.そこで,研究ではユーザへ負担をかけることなく,生活の中で多くの情報と接するための「眺めるインタフェース」を提案する.眺めるインタフェースとは,ユーザに過度の注意を求めることなく,さまざまな活動の合間に,情報を容易に獲得するためのインタフェースである.我々は,眺めるインタフェースの具体的実装として Memorium というシステムを試作した.Memorium は,ユーザが蓄積するメモやキーワードをもとに,それら

  • お宝ワッショイ

    お宝ワッショイ 0.3b 興味のあるキーワードをいれてくれ。単純なのが好きだ。難しいことはわかない。(BGMも聞いてくれ) まずは「iPod」あたりくらいがちょうどいかもな。固有名詞が好きだ。キーワードによってはでてこない。 お宝はクリックできる。新規ウインドウで開くようになっている。 (ポップアップの許可を求められる場合があるが、ポップアップではなく新規ウインドウなだけであるので安心してくれ) 大きく表示 出てくるお宝は、また土に帰るのだ。そして、また生まれる。 (06/04/10更新) http://www.persistent.org/

  • Google

    世界中のあらゆる情報を検索するためのツールを提供しています。さまざまな検索機能を活用して、お探しの情報を見つけてください。

    Google
  • Google Visualization API - Google Code

    注意: 一部のページは英語でのみご利用いただけます。 利用方法 デベロッパー ガイドを読みます。 より深く知りたい場合は、API リファレンスを読みます。 ガジェットを開発する場合は、ガジェット拡張ガイドを読みます。 ビジュアライゼーション ギャラリーにアクセスします。 ビジュアライã‚

  • メンテナンスフリー!郵便番号から住所を返すライブラリ·ajaxzip3 MOONGIFT

    Webシステムを開発している中で郵便番号を入力したら自動的に住所を補完して欲しいという要望は多々ある。実装はそれほど難しいものではない。厄介なのはメンテナンスだろう。市区町村の統廃合によってデータが変わった場合の対応だ。 郵便番号から住所に変換する便利なライブラリ 郵便局から配布されているCSVを都度取り込むという方法もあるが、非常に面倒だ。そこで使ってみたいのがajaxzip3だ。 今回紹介するオープンソース・ソフトウェアはajaxzip3、Ajaxを使って住所を取得するライブラリだ。 ajaxzip3の面白い所はライブラリをGoogle Code上にアップロードしてそのまま利用できてしまう点だ。規約上どうなのかという問題はあるが、そのまま使うと自分でメンテナンスする必要が全くなくなってしまう。自分のサーバであってもajaxzip3を外部のSubversionリポジトリからアップロードす

    メンテナンスフリー!郵便番号から住所を返すライブラリ·ajaxzip3 MOONGIFT
  • PHPとYahoo!の意外なカンケイ

    ヤフー株式会社は、2023年10月1日にLINEヤフー株式会社になりました。LINEヤフー株式会社の新しいブログはこちらです。LINEヤフー Tech Blog こんにちは。オークション事業部 企画部の安田 琢磨です。 多少技術的表現に誤りあるかもしれませんが、ご容赦ください。 Webサービスは、SOAP,REST,JSONなどに基づいて提供されることが多いので、HTTPの通信に対応していればどのプログラミング言語からでも利用可能です。では、実際にWebサービスを利用して、何か作ってみようと言う場合にどの言語を選択すればよいのか、環境は? DBは? または、初心者の日曜プログラマーでも作れるのか? などいろいろ疑問が出てくる方もいらっしゃるかもしれません。 Yahoo!オークションWebサービスで公開されているSDK(ソフトウエア開発キット)は、現在PHPでのサンプルコードを公開しています

    PHPとYahoo!の意外なカンケイ
    basi
    basi 2009/02/22
  • Webアプリ開発における「内部APIモデル」 - Tous Les Jours 攻防記

    前回の話は、一回のエントリーでは書ききれない内容でした。。以下もうすこし詳しく書き直してみます。 Webアプリ開発における「内部APIモデル」とは、ネットワーク越しに外部サイトのWebAPIを呼び出すかのごとく、自サイト内のリソースに対して内部専用のWebAPIでアクセスする仕組みを導入し、分散処理を行うモデルのことです。典型的なWebアプリでは、データベースがここでいうリソースに該当するかと思います。 図にすると以下のようなイメージです。 今回、Lang-8で実際に「内部APIモデル」を導入してみたので、気づきの点などをこのエントリーにまとめてみました。 ※導入のいきさつについては、前回のエントリーで触れています。 「内部APIモデル」を採用するメリット Webアプリ開発において「内部APIモデル」を採用するメリットは2つあります。 (1)言語やフレームワークの選択自由度が上がる 現在運

    Webアプリ開発における「内部APIモデル」 - Tous Les Jours 攻防記
  • 郵便番号等からリアルタイムに地図をサジェストできる「Mapeed.AddressChooser」:phpspot開発日誌

    郵便番号等からリアルタイムに地図をサジェストできる「Mapeed.AddressChooser」 2009年01月12日- Mapeed.AddressChooser API documentation | Home 郵便番号等からリアルタイムに地図をサジェストできる「Mapeed.AddressChooser」。 試しに郵便番号を入力していくと、地図がリアルタイムに切り替わって位置を表示してくれます。 入力補完や、正確な緯度・経度の入力に使えそう。 サンプルは、Street, City, Zip Code, State といった感じの英語表記になっていますが、zip code だけであればそのまま使えます。 ライブラリをちょっと変えれば日語にも対応できそうです。 関連エントリ 超クールな複数アイテムの入力補完用JavaScriptライブラリ クールなJavaScript入力補完ライブラ

  • PHP SERIALIZEのススメ

    ヤフー株式会社は、2023年10月1日にLINEヤフー株式会社になりました。LINEヤフー株式会社の新しいブログはこちらです。LINEヤフー Tech Blog オークション事業部 開発部のやまけんです。 遅ればせながら、新年明けましておめでとうございます。 さて、オークションTechBlogも第4回目となりました。 今回はWebAPIとしての一つの形態であるPHP Serializeに関してお話します。 WebAPIは、一般的にはRESTと呼ばれるXMLを主体としたレスポンスを返却し、呼び側がXMLを解析するというものが主流となっています。 (RESTには、RESTfulと呼ばれる概念がありますが、それはまた別の機会にお話したいと思います) さて、PHP Serializeですが、これはPHP言語で表現されるデータやクラスをサーバー側で文字列化して、呼び側でデータやクラスに復元するという

    PHP SERIALIZEのススメ
  • TechCrunch | Startup and Technology News

    Welcome to Startups Weekly — Haje‘s weekly recap of everything you can’t miss from the world of startups. Sign up here to get it in your inbox every Friday. Well,…

    TechCrunch | Startup and Technology News
    basi
    basi 2009/01/08
  • PHP5からdel.icio.usのAPIに簡単アクセスできるラッパークラスライブラリ「PhpDelicious」:phpspot開発日誌

    PHP5からdel.icio.usのAPIに簡単アクセスできるラッパークラスライブラリ「PhpDelicious」 2008年01月23日- PhpDelicious - a wrapper class for the del.icio.us API PhpDelicious is a PHP 5 library for accessing the del.icio.us API.PHP5からdel.icio.usのAPIに簡単アクセスできるラッパークラスライブラリ「PhpDelicious」。 AddPost, DeletePost などによってブックマークの投稿、削除が出来、GetPostsによって投稿を取得したり出来るようです。 若干ドキュメントが不備な状態ですが、Pearレスで簡単にdel.icio.us の APIを使う場合には便利かもしれませんね。